Job summary

A healthcare facility in North East England is seeking a General Practice Assistant (GPA) who will support GPs with both clinical and administrative tasks. The position requires experience in taking blood, competence in SystmOne, and a calm demeanor under pressure. Successful candidates will handle clinical observations, arrange patient appointments, and manage data entry. A qualification in Phlebotomy and NVQ Level 2/3 are essential. Responsibilities

  • Complete clinical observations/investigations like dipstick urine, blood pressure, ECG.
  • Support GP with immunisations and wound care.
  • Prepare patients before consultations, taking history and readings.
  • Explain treatment procedures to patients.
  • Arrange appointments, referrals, and tests for patients.
  • Extract and code information from clinical letters.
  • Input data and conduct clinical searches.
